Diseases like dengue have raised their ugly head once again across the country. The government in Delhi has said that there are about 1000 cases reported, experts say the problem is being played down. On the other hand, the HIV/Ads Bill, a result of government and civil society collaboration, finalised by the National AIDS Control Organization (NACO) in July 2006, continues to be pending with the government and has not been tabled in the Parliament till date. A NewsX investigation now shows that incentives meant for patients suffering from Leprosy doesn't reach them.
